How does cupboard's moisture-proof properties effectively protect kitchen utensils?

Publish Time: 2025-09-22
The kitchen is one of the most frequently used rooms in the home and is also the area where moisture and cooking fumes are most concentrated. Everyday activities like washing vegetables, cooking, and washing dishes generate a large amount of moisture. This is especially true in humid southern regions or during the rainy season, where humidity is chronically high. This can easily lead to moisture, mold, deformation, and even bacterial growth in cupboard. Cupboard's moisture-proof properties are not only an important quality criterion but also a key factor in protecting kitchen utensils, extending their lifespan, and safeguarding the health of your family.

1. Moisture-proof Materials Are the Foundation

High-quality cupboard typically uses a highly moisture-proof substrate, such as moisture-proof board, solid wood multilayer board, or specially treated density fiberboard. Moisture-proof board is treated with a moisture-proof agent and molded under high temperature and pressure to effectively block moisture penetration. Compared to ordinary particleboard, moisture-proof board is less likely to expand or deform in humid environments, maintaining structural stability. Furthermore, some high-end cupboards feature waterproof edge banding, using PVC or ABS edge banding to tightly wrap the board edges and prevent moisture from entering through the seams. This dual protection, encompassing both material and craftsmanship, provides a dry and safe storage environment for kitchen items.

2. Protect Kitchen Supplies from Moisture and Deterioration

Many items stored in the kitchen are sensitive to moisture. For example, dry goods like flour, sugar, coffee, and tea, once exposed to moisture, will not only clump and spoil, but may also breed mold, compromising food safety. Seasonings like salt and chicken bouillon tend to clump after absorbing moisture, affecting the user experience. And wooden cutting boards and chopsticks, if left in a damp environment for extended periods, are prone to mold, odors, and even the growth of harmful bacteria. Moisture-resistant cupboards effectively isolate moisture, keeping the cabinet dry, thereby extending the shelf life of these items and ensuring healthy eating. Furthermore, electrical appliances such as rice cookers and microwave ovens can short-circuit or malfunction due to internal moisture if stored in a damp cabinet. Moisture-resistant cupboards provide a safer storage space for these items.

3. Preventing Damage to the Cupboard, Extending Its Lifespan

Moisture not only affects the items inside the cabinet but also directly damages the cupboard itself. Ordinary wood panels easily swell and bubble when exposed to water, causing door panel deformation, cabinet cracking, loose hinges, and drawer jamming. Moisture-resistant cupboard effectively resists moisture erosion, maintaining structural stability and ensuring smooth door and drawer opening and closing. This not only improves the user experience but also significantly extends the overall lifespan of the cupboard, reducing repair and replacement costs and generating greater economic value in the long run.

4. Maintaining Kitchen Hygiene and Air Quality

A humid environment is a breeding ground for mold and mites. Ordinary cupboard, exposed to moisture for a long time, is prone to black spots and mildew in the corners. This not only affects the appearance but also releases harmful spores, polluting the kitchen air and being particularly harmful to people with respiratory sensitivities. Moisture-resistant cupboard effectively inhibits mold growth, keeping the cabinet interior clean and hygienic, and creating a healthier and safer kitchen environment.
